<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I was interested to read the posts on the Lerigo family as in my first job in the early 1960s in Hereford, my supervisor was Phyllis Gwen Lerego who married George A Cornwell in 1958 (b 1910) later in life and had no children.  I believe she came from Ross on Wye.<br />
I have just checked up on her and found the following though I haven't got time to put the full Census entries and no doubt you can look them up if you need to.</p>
<p>Phyllis' parents were Percy Harold Lerego and Martha Annie Thackaway who married in Ross in 1907.  Percy had at least six siblings so there may be issue from them.</p>
<p>Percy's parents were Thomas Lerego and Elizabeth Toomer who married in Ross in 1882.</p>
<p>Thomas's parents were Thomas (1815) and Sarah Greenaway in married in Ross in 1841.</p>
<p>There are several Leregos on the 1841 Census in the Ross/Monmouth areas born in the late 1700s but there is no knowing if any of them are parents of Thomas (1815).</p>

<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I would like to make contact with any descendants of Thomas LERIGO and Elizabeth COOK, who married at Newland on 10 May 1788. Both parties signed, and witnesses were John COOK and Thomas BOND. It is possible that Thomas and Elizabeth had ten children in English Bicknor and Welsh Bicknor between 1788 and 1808.<br />
I am particularly interested in learning whether Elizabeth was baptised at English Bicknor on 28 July 1765, the daughter of John Cook, and whether anyone knows the name of John's wife. It was possibly Sarah, maiden name not known.<br />
